England vs India 1st Test: Can India Win at Headingley?

Sandra Wills by Sandra Wills
06/19/2025
in Cricket Updates
0 0
0
siraj
Share on FacebookShare on Twitter

Get ready for an exciting cricket match! England and India will face off on June 20, 2025. This is the first Test cricket game of a five-match series. It happens at Headingley stadium in Leeds, a famous spot.

Both teams are part of the ICC World Test Championship. India’s new captain, Shubman Gill, leads a young squad. England, with Ben Stokes as captain, wants to win at home. The Anderson-Tendulkar Trophy makes this series special.

Headingley is tricky with its wild weather and pitch. India has won here before but also lost badly. Stars like Joe Root and Jasprit Bumrah will shine. Fans can’t wait to see who takes the lead. What’s the Pitch Like at Headingley?

Gaddafi Stadium Lahore Pitch Report

The pitch at Headingley Stadium is a big deal. It looks green before the game starts. This means bowlers might get help early on. The ball could swing and bounce a lot.

But don’t worry, it changes as the match goes on. The pitch should get better for batting later. Sunny weather is coming for all five days. This will dry the pitch and help batters score runs.

In recent games here, teams chose to bowl first. The green pitch helps fast bowlers at the start. England has Chris Woakes and Brydon Carse ready to strike. India’s Jasprit Bumrah and Mohammed Siraj are just as strong.

Batters need to be patient early in the game. If they survive, they can make big scores. The sun might even bring some spin later. Ravindra Jadeja could use this to trick England.

Headingley is famous for being unpredictable. The pitch might favor bowlers one day, batters the next. This keeps the game exciting for everyone watching. Both teams must plan smartly to win, like India against New Zealand in CT 2025.

Who’s Playing and What to Expect?

Both teams have picked their players for this match. England’s team includes Zak Crawley and Ben Duckett to start batting. Joe Root is their star in the middle. Ben Stokes leads as captain and all-rounder.

Jamie Smith will keep wickets for England. Chris Woakes is back to bowl fast. Brydon Carse and Josh Tongue join him with pace. Shoaib Bashir is their only spinner.

India’s lineup has Yashasvi Jaiswal and KL Rahul opening. Karun Nair returns after eight years at No. 3. Shubman Gill bats and leads as captain.

Rishabh Pant keeps wickets and hits big shots. Ravindra Jadeja bowls spin and bats well. Nitish Reddy and Shardul Thakur add extra skills. Jasprit Bumrah leads the fast bowlers with Mohammed Siraj.

England wants to attack with speed and spin. They’ll use home advantage at Headingley. India mixes young players with stars like Bumrah. They aim to surprise everyone.

Expect a close fight between bat and ball. England might start strong with Stokes leading. India could strike back with Jadeja and Pant. Both teams are missing old heroes like Anderson, Kohli, and Rohit. This match will test new players. Who will step up? Stars Who Could Steal the Show

Some players could make this match amazing. Joe Root is England’s best batter right now. He’s scored tons of runs against India. But Jasprit Bumrah has gotten him out 9 times.

Bumrah is India’s top bowler and a game-changer like Glenn McGrath. He’s super fast and accurate with the ball. He’s close to a big record in Test cricket. Five more wickets, and he’ll make history. Ben Stokes is England’s captain and all-round hero. He can bat, bowl, and inspire his team. His energy might lift England at Headingley. He loves these big moments.

Shubman Gill is India’s new leader. He’ll bat at No. 4 and set the tone. Everyone’s watching how he handles captaincy. Can he stay calm under pressure, as we have seen India having an upset against Zimbabwe under his captaincy?

Rishabh Pant is India’s wild card. He hits the ball hard and fast. His style could turn the game around. England needs to watch him closely. Chris Woakes is back for England. He’s great at home and bowls tirelessly. Ravindra Jadeja is India’s spin star. He’s the best all-rounder in the world.

England vs. India at Headingley: A Look Back

England and India have played some amazing matches at Headingley. Their first Test here was way back in 1952, and England won by seven wickets. Since then, it’s been a battle every time. India had a huge win in 2002, scoring 628 runs with Sachin Tendulkar smashing 193.

They crushed England that day! But England has had big moments too, like in 2021 when they bowled India out for just 78 runs. Headingley is full of surprises. England usually does well here, but India knows how to fight back. This year, both teams want to add a new chapter to this rivalry, like India in CT 2025. Fans can’t wait to see what happens next!
